In reported speech, you need to pay attention to the tense in the direct speech since you need to transpose it into past tense, most of the time. You may also need to pay attention to pronouns, although here it is not necessary.
In the example, the teacher said: "mammals are warm blooded animals," the reported speech will be:
The teacher said that mammals were warm blooded animals.
The present tense in the direct speech becomes simple past tense. So remember to transpose/change the tense in the reported speech.
Below are three main patterns you can apply:
- If verb in direct speech is Simple Present -> it becomes Simple Past in reported speech.
- If verb in direct speech is Present Continuous -> it becomes Past Continuous in reported speech.
- If verb in direct speech is Present Perfect -> it becomes Past Perfect in reported speech.
